I have had ringworm around my anal area for the last 3 weeks, and the patches are increasing in size with severe itching. What should I do?

Asked by Male, 34 ยท 18 days ago

Ringworm around the anal area that is spreading and very itchy needs proper antifungal treatment. Keep the area clean and completely dry, and wear loose cotton undergarments. Avoid scratching and do not use steroid creams, as they can worsen fungal infection. Consult a doctor for appropriate treatment to prevent further spread.
